Transaction 67108e8223cfcf19d33f04d4b5ee582e6aab1feeef3f14bd915273ded01ff538
1 Input
2 Outputs
- 67108e8223cfcf19d33f04d4b5ee582e6aab1feeef3f14bd915273ded01ff538:0
- 67108e8223cfcf19d33f04d4b5ee582e6aab1feeef3f14bd915273ded01ff538:1
value 34433548
address 3HWHCDCiR7QvU2YpkU1b83FgutfFTxN2th
value 368889078
address 1NC3CbmdZJnvNBHGetSo6ae5kpXoM8Cgp2